PTO Shaft Structure & Function on the Wheeled Tractor

The power take-off (PTO) shaft is positioned between the rear of the tractor and the front input of the wheeled tractor. It is a two-piece telescoping assembly connected by universal joints at each end. The tractor-end yoke mates with the PTO stub shaft, while the implement-end yoke connects to the wheeled tractor’s gearbox input.

When engaged, rotational power flows from the tractor’s engine through the PTO gearbox, out the stub, through the first U-joint, along the profile tube, through the second U-joint, and into the implement. During general tractor power transmission, this power drives the cutting, turning, or processing mechanism of the wheeled tractor.

Key structural components include: hardened splined yokes for positive engagement, needle-bearing U-joint crosses for smooth rotation under load, telescoping tubes for length adjustment, plastic safety shields with bearing-supported rotation, and an overload clutch or shear pin to protect the entire driveline from catastrophic failure.

Installation Guide – PTO Shaft on Wheeled Tractor

⚠ Warning: Always shut down the tractor engine, disengage the PTO, and wait for all rotating parts to stop completely before beginning installation. Follow your tractor and implement manufacturer’s safety instructions.

Step 1: Pre-Installation Inspection

Unpack the PTO shaft and inspect all components for shipping damage. Verify that the yoke splines, U-joints, profile tubes, and safety guards are in perfect condition. Confirm the shaft series and length match your wheeled tractor requirements.

Step 2: Set Correct Shaft Length

Park the tractor with the wheeled tractor in its normal working position. Measure the distance from the tractor PTO stub face to the implement input shaft face. Adjust the telescoping tubes so that the shaft closed length is approximately 10–15 mm shorter than this measured distance to allow for suspension travel.

Step 3: Connect Tractor-End Yoke

Slide the tractor-end yoke onto the PTO stub shaft. Ensure the splines engage fully and the locking mechanism (push-pin or collar) clicks into place. Verify there is no excessive radial play.

Step 4: Connect Implement-End Yoke

Align the implement-end yoke with the wheeled tractor’s input shaft. Slide the yoke onto the splines or into the keyway and secure with the appropriate locking mechanism. If a torque limiter is present, ensure it is correctly oriented per the manufacturer’s markings.

Step 5: Install Safety Guards

Slide the guard halves over the shaft and connect them using the supplied clips. Attach the guard retention chains—one to the tractor drawbar or a fixed point, one to the implement frame. The guards must be able to rotate freely and must never be attached to a rotating component.

Step 6: Final Check & Test Run

Verify all connections are secure. Start the tractor engine and engage the PTO at idle speed. Observe the shaft for smooth rotation, unusual vibration, or noise. Gradually increase to operating speed. Re-check all fasteners after the first hour of operation.

PTO Shaft Troubleshooting Guide for Wheeled Tractor

Symptom Possible Cause Recommended Action
PTO shaft disconnects during operation Worn locking collar; damaged retaining groove on PTO stub Replace quick-release yoke; inspect and repair PTO stub groove if worn
Heat build-up at U-joint Insufficient lubrication; excessive operating angle; bearing failure Grease U-joints immediately; reduce operating angle; replace cross kit if bearings are damaged
Shaft will not telescope smoothly Corrosion or debris in profile tubes; insufficient lubrication Clean and grease profile tubes; replace if scoring is visible
Shear bolt breaks repeatedly Implement blockage not cleared; wrong bolt grade used; shaft undersized Clear blockage source; use only specified bolt grade; consider upgrading to next shaft series
Clicking or knocking noise at low speed Worn U-joint needle bearings; loose yoke on PTO stub Replace U-joint assembly; check spline wear and yoke locking mechanism
Safety guard not rotating freely Guard bearings seized; guard damaged or misaligned Replace guard bearings; straighten or replace guard halves; re-attach chains correctly
Implement speed inconsistent PTO shaft slipping; worn splines; clutch partially engaged Check yoke engagement; replace yoke if splines are worn; adjust or replace clutch assembly
Unusual whining or grinding sound Gearbox input bearing failure; misaligned shaft Inspect implement gearbox; re-align tractor and implement; check shaft length overlap

❓ What is the difference between a shear bolt and a friction clutch?

A shear bolt is a sacrificial pin that breaks when torque exceeds its rated capacity. It is inexpensive but requires manual replacement after each event. A friction clutch slips when overloaded and automatically re-engages when the overload clears, offering uninterrupted operation in applications prone to frequent shock loads.

❓ How do I measure the correct closed length?

Hitch the implement to the tractor in its normal working position. Measure the straight-line distance from the face of the tractor PTO stub to the face of the implement input shaft. The shaft closed length should be approximately 10–15 mm less than this measurement.

❓ What causes premature U-joint failure?

Common causes include insufficient lubrication, excessive operating angles (over 25°), running at speeds higher than rated, misalignment between tractor and implement, and lack of regular inspection. Following the recommended maintenance schedule significantly extends U-joint life.

❓ How often should I grease the PTO shaft?

Grease all U-joint nipples every 8–10 hours of operation, or at the start of each working day. Grease the telescoping profile tubes at the same interval. Use EP2 lithium-complex grease or as recommended in your product manual.
